4. Setup

4.1 Installazzjoni tal-batterija

The COOSPO BK9C Cadence Sensor uses one CR2032 coin cell battery. The battery may be pre-installed, but if not, or if replacement is needed, follow these steps:

  1. Sib l-għatu tal-batterija fuq wara tas-sensor.
  2. Use a coin to twist the battery cover counter-clockwise to open it.
  3. Daħħal il-batterija CR2032 bin-naħa pożittiva (+) tħares 'il fuq.
  4. Align the battery cover and twist clockwise to secure it.

4.2 Immuntar tas-Sensor

The BK9C sensor is designed for easy, magnet-free installation on your bicycle's crank arm.

  1. Select a suitable rubber band from the package.
  2. Place the sensor on the inside of your bicycle's crank arm.
  3. Secure the sensor firmly to the crank arm using the rubber bands. Ensure the sensor is stable and does not move during cycling.

5. Istruzzjonijiet Operattivi

5.1 Activating the Sensor

After installation, the sensor will activate automatically when it detects movement. Rotate your bike's crank arm a few times to wake up the sensor. A blue LED indicator light will flash briefly to confirm activation.

5.2 Pairing with Devices and Applications

The COOSPO BK9C Cadence Sensor supports both Bluetooth 5.0 and ANT+ connectivity, allowing it to pair with a wide range of cycling apps, GPS bike computers, and smartwatches.

Diagram showing correct and incorrect methods for connecting the COOSPO BK9C Cadence Sensor to smartphone apps
Image: A visual guide detailing the correct procedure for connecting the COOSPO BK9C Cadence Sensor to smartphone applications, contrasting it with common incorrect methods.

General Pairing Steps:

  1. Ensure the sensor is awake by rotating the crank arm.
  2. Enable Bluetooth or ANT+ on your receiving device (smartphone, bike computer, smartwatch).
  3. Open your preferred cycling application (e.g., Rouvy, Zwift, Peloton, Wahoo) or navigate to the sensor pairing menu on your bike computer/smartwatch.
  4. Fittex għal new sensors. The BK9C should appear in the list.
  5. Select the BK9C sensor to pair. Once connected, the app/device will display real-time cadence data.

Note: Some applications, such as the Wahoo app, may have limitations on pairing multiple third-party sensors simultaneously.

6. Manutenzjoni

6.1 Sostituzzjoni tal-batterija

The COOSPO BK9C Cadence Sensor provides approximately 300 hours of battery life. When the battery is low, the sensor's performance may become inconsistent, or it may fail to connect. Replace the CR2032 battery as described in Section 4.1.

6.2 Tindif u Ħażna

The sensor has an IP67 waterproof rating, meaning it is protected against temporary immersion in water. However, to ensure longevity:

  • Imsaħ is-sensor bl-adamp drapp biex tnaddafha.
  • Do not soak the sensor in water or clean it with high-pressure water jets.
  • Store the sensor in a cool, dry place when not in use for extended periods.

7 Issolvi l-problemi

If you encounter issues with your COOSPO BK9C Cadence Sensor, refer to the following common problems and solutions:

  • Sensor Not Connecting/Waking Up:
    • Kun żgur li l-batterija hija installata sew u għandha biżżejjed ċarġ. Ibdelha jekk meħtieġ.
    • Rotate the crank arm for at least 15-30 seconds to wake the sensor. The blue LED should flash.
    • Check that Bluetooth/ANT+ is enabled on your receiving device.
    • Move the sensor closer to your receiving device during pairing.
    • Restart your receiving device and the cycling application.
  • Inaccurate Cadence Readings:
    • Ensure the sensor is securely mounted on the crank arm and not moving or vibrating excessively.
    • Check for any obstructions or interference near the sensor.
    • Verify that the sensor is correctly identified as a cadence sensor in your application settings.
  • Ħajja Qasira tal-Batterija:
    • Ensure you are using a fresh, high-quality CR2032 battery.
    • Temperaturi estremi jistgħu jaffettwaw il-prestazzjoni tal-batterija.
